- Skaaning JacobsonNov 12, 2024 · 2 years agoOne effective strategy to establish and manage a sinking fund for cryptocurrencies is to automate your contributions. By setting up automatic transfers or investments into your sinking fund, you can ensure consistent and disciplined saving. This removes the temptation to skip contributions during market downturns or when you feel uncertain about the cryptocurrency market. Automating your sinking fund contributions can help you stay on track with your financial goals and build a solid reserve over time.
- Holmgaard KjeldsenJan 21, 2022 · 4 years agoA key strategy for managing a sinking fund for cryptocurrencies is to have a clear exit plan. Determine specific price targets or timeframes at which you will liquidate a portion of your sinking fund and take profits. This can help you lock in gains and protect your investments from potential market reversals. It's important to regularly review and adjust your exit plan based on market conditions and your investment objectives. Having a well-defined exit plan can provide you with peace of mind and help you make informed decisions.
